My ideal wrestling dream match

When I think of dream matches I always think of a one on one confrontation between 2 icons of wrestling that would have me on the edge of my seat all the way through. Usually I hear from some people that they want a special stipulation for there dream match, I always thought that may be a good idea but recently I am thinking that the reason stipulations are added to normal matches is because the one on one match between 2 wrestlers is not enough to garner the fans interest.

To me if you put a stipulation on a dream match, then it ceases to be a dream match. As it is possible to have just 2 wrestlers doing what they do best in the middle of the ring and for that match to be beyond any expectations. For example Ric Flair vs Ricky Steamboat in the 80's they had hundreds of matches each match better than the last, and the fact that both men were such great wrestlers scientifically ensured that the fans would be getting a fantastic match.

For my dream match I would have The Rock vs Shawn Michaels, 2 of the greatest entertainers in WWE history. If you go back to 2000 and just watch The Rock come down to the ring and listen to the reaction he gets from the crowd it is beyond anything I have seen before. And just watch anytime Shawn Michaels music hits the fans go crazy for HBK.

My point with this is that what measures a dream match is not who does the flashiest moves, it's not who flies out the ring the most time and it's not how many household appliances are used during this match. The thing that makes a wrestling match the best is the reaction of the fans, for example The Rock vs Hulk Hogan at Wrestlemania 18 take away the chants and cheers for both men and you are left with a sub par match. If there is a lot of reaction from the crowd and both wrestlers or one of them has limited wrestling skills as long as they know what they are doing then you don't need a fantastic catch as catch can repertoire.

And The Rock vs Shawn Michaels would no doubt get huge reactions, 2 of the most popular wrestlers in WWE history; it really wouldn't matter on how great they were in the ring as long as there is a fair amount of crowd interaction the match will seem better than it is based on just wrestling skill. Hulk Hogan vs Ultimate Warrior pretty much proves my point on that.

And the fact that The Rock and Shawn Michaels are fantastic wrestlers would make this match even more enjoyable, both men obtain a large amount of ring psychology and popularity and that's what would make this a true dream match.
